806f011b-0701xxxx The connector
PwrPaddle Cable has
encountered a
configuration error.
Info The connector
PwrPaddle Cable
has encountered a
configuration error.
1. Reseat the power paddle cable on
the system board.
2. Replace the power paddle cable.
3. (Trained technician only) Replace
the system board.
806f0308-0a01xxxx
806f0308-0a02xxxx
The Power Supply n
has lost input.
(n = power supply
number)
Info Power supply n AC
has lost.
(n = power supply
number)
1. Reconnect the power cords.
2. Check power supply n LED.
3. See “Power-supply LEDs” on page
135 for more information.
(n = power supply number)
80070208-0a01xxxx
80070208-0a02xxxx
Sensor PS n Therm
Fault has transitioned
to critical from a less
severe state.
(n = power supply
number)
Error A sensor has
changed to Critical
state from a less
severe state.
1. Make sure that there are no
obstructions, such as bundled
cables, to the airflow from the
power-supply fan.
2. Use the IBM Power Configurator
utility to determine current system
power consumption. For more
information and to download the
utility, go to http://www-03.ibm.com/
systems/bladecenter/resources/
powerconfig.html.
3. Replace power supply n.
(n = power supply number)
80070608-0a01xxxx
80070608-0a02xxxx
Sensor PS n 12V
AUX Fault has
transitioned to
non-recoverable from
a less severe state.
(n = power supply
number)
Error A sensor has
changed to
non-recoverable
state from a less
severe state.
1. Check power supply n LED.
2. Replace power supply n.
(n = power supply number)
